Cost of Garage Floor Pouring in Bothell
When considering home improvement projects, one critical aspect often overlooked is the garage floor. In Bothell, WA, the cost of pouring a new garage floor can vary significantly based on several factors. Understanding these variables can help homeowners budget more effectively and achieve the best results for their investment.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Garage: Larger garages require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Material Quality: Higher-quality concrete and finishing materials can elevate the price.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Bothell, WA, can vary, affecting the total expenditure.
- Preparation Work: The need for extensive site preparation, such as leveling the ground, can add to the costs.
- Thickness of the Slab: Thicker slabs require more concrete, which can increase the price.
- Additional Features: Features like radiant heating or decorative finishes will add to the c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
| Task | Average Cost (Bothell, WA) |
|---|---|
| Basic Concrete Pouring | $4 - $8 per square foot |
| High-Quality Concrete Pouring | $8 - $12 per square foot |
| Site Preparation | $1,000 - $2,500 |
| Reinforcement (Rebar) | $2 - $3 per square foot |
| Decorative Finishes | $5 - $10 per square foot |
| Radiant Heating Installation | $10 - $20 per square foot |
